Understanding Porosity in Welding



Porosity in welding, a common concern experienced by welders, describes the existence of gas pockets or spaces in the bonded material, which can compromise the honesty and top quality of the weld. These gas pockets are usually trapped throughout the welding process due to different elements such as inappropriate protecting gas, infected base products, or incorrect welding criteria. The development of porosity can weaken the weld, making it vulnerable to splitting and rust, inevitably bring about architectural failings.


By identifying the significance of preserving correct gas shielding, making sure the cleanliness of base materials, and enhancing welding settings, welders can considerably reduce the probability of porosity development. In general, an extensive understanding of porosity in welding is important for welders to produce high-grade and durable welds.

Techniques for Porosity Prevention



Carrying out efficient safety nets is critical in minimizing the occurrence of porosity in welding processes. One technique for porosity prevention is making certain correct cleansing of the base metal before welding. Contaminants such as oil, oil, look at more info rust, and paint can bring about porosity, so complete cleaning utilizing suitable solvents or mechanical approaches is vital.




One more key safety net is the selection of the ideal welding consumables. Making use of premium filler materials and securing gases that appropriate for the base steel and welding procedure can dramatically lower the threat of porosity. Furthermore, preserving appropriate welding specifications, such as voltage, current, travel speed, and gas circulation price, is important for porosity avoidance. Drifting from the advised settings can cause incorrect gas protection and poor blend, resulting in porosity.


In addition, utilizing correct welding methods, such as keeping a consistent traveling speed, electrode angle, and arc size, can help protect against porosity (What is Porosity). Sufficient training of welders to ensure they comply with ideal methods and quality assurance procedures is likewise necessary in reducing porosity issues in welding
